Who shows the budget in Parliament?

Who shows the budget in Parliament?

the Finance Minister of India
India. The Union Budget of India, referred to as the Annual Financial Statement in Article 112 of the Constitution of India, is the annual budget of the Republic of India, presented each year on the very first day of February by the Finance Minister of India in Parliament.

Who presents the annual budget to the House of Commons?

the Chancellor of the Exchequer
Each year the Chancellor of the Exchequer presents the Budget, which contains all the tax measures for the year ahead. Traditionally the Budget has been in March, prior to the start of the tax year on 6 April.

Who present the annual budget of Britain?

The budget is one of two statements given by the Chancellor of the Exchequer, with the Spring Statement being given the following year. Budgets are usually set once every year and are announced in the House of Commons by the Chancellor of the Exchequer.

Who is responsible for budget preparation?

the ministry of finance
The responsibility for preparing the budget usually lies with the ministry of finance with input from the line ministries and some smaller spending agencies. This exercise is normally controlled by a central budget department located in the ministry of finance, or sometimes in a separate budget ministry.

Who is responsible for the budget in government?

The Department of Finance and the Reserve Bank create three-year projections of what is likely to happen in the economy to estimate how much tax revenue the government can expect. On the basis Page 2 of this study the Department of Finance, which is ultimately responsible for the budget, prepares a fiscal framework.

How budget is passed in Parliament?

In the Lok Sabha, the finance minister presents the budget. In the Lok Sabha, he presents his budget. At the same time, a copy of the budget is placed on the Rajya Sabha’s table. Members of the parliament are given printed copies of the budget to go over the intricacies of the budgetary measures.

Who writes budget?

The budget is prepared by the Finance Minister with the assistance of number of advisors and bureaucrats. The Finance Minister seeks the view of the industry captains and economists prior to preparation. Various accounting and finance related organisations send in their opinions and suggestions .

What government agency has the lowest budget?

The Department of Commerce has the smallest budget of any Cabinet department, with direct obligations of $8 billion in fiscal year 2012.

What branches get the most funding?

In the fiscal 2020 defense budget request, based on the pool of money allocated to the base budgets of the services alone, 35.6 percent goes to the Air Force, 27.9 percent goes to the Army, and 36.4 percent goes to the Navy (including the Marine Corps).
